After hearing appraiser-based rent and comparable‑sales arguments from the taxpayer’s representative, Dickinson commissioners approved lowering Sanford's Grub & Pub's assessed value to $1,700,000.
The Dickinson City Commission on Jan. 6 approved a reduced assessed value for the Sanford's Grub & Pub property, setting the 2023 assessment at $1,700,000.
Jim Dahl of Ryan LLC, representing the taxpayer, presented a valuation based on the property’s triple‑net lease and rent roll and cited local sale comparables; he said his client’s last offer was $1.6 million. Assessor Dickinson said staff had not seen objective materials that would support a change but acknowledged appraisal approaches and data limitations when recreating market conditions for prior years.
Commissioner Frederick moved to change the assessed value to $1,700,000.0; the motion was seconded and passed with all commissioners voting aye.
The vote resolves the 2023 abatement appeal for Sanford’s Grub & Pub on the commission’s agenda; Mr. Dahl indicated parties may discuss subsequent assessment years informally rather than filing further abatements.
